Use What You've Got

Before you go off spending your life savings to spruce up your home with expensive projects, ask yourself the question, "What attractive features does my home already possess?" Do you have beautiful hardwood floors?

 

Were you enamored with your home's wooden beams? What about its built-in features--fireplaces, bookshelves, or cabinets? These things can give a home its character, especially when they are perked up. Maybe you can make them more prominent.

 

Clean and maintain them. Do not let your bookshelf become a catch-all for random items. Give your home a good cleaning, paying special attention to these features. Wax and polish your hardwood, to give it a luxurious-looking luster.

Knick Knacks

Apart from these things, you can do other little things that make your home stand out. Purchase towels that are vivid, colorful, and will be attractive to guests. Rejuvenate that sofa with new pillows that make it look like you purchased new furniture. Strategically placing interesting and eye-catching items throughout your home to make it look like you have a home in which someone has invested much, whether or not you actually spent an arm and a leg.

 

Paint the Town

There is nothing like a splash of color to liven up a room or an entire section of a home. Choose a color that goes well with what you have, but will provide a nice contrast. Fresh coats of paint not only spices up your home's look, but adds to its retail value.

 

Use colors that are brighter to give your room a larger, more spacious look. If you are opting for a cozier feel, then choose colors that are warmer and darker.

 

Shed Some Light on the Subject

Lighting can change the entire look and feel of your home. Use softer, warmer light bulbs to generate a cozy, inviting feel. Maybe get rid of outdated lighting systems. You don't have to break the bank. Use smaller simple track lighting or something more updated. It can give your home a more modern look.
